ROCK HILL, S.C. – Coming off a stretch in which the Eagles dropped two of three at Charleston Southern to move to 15-18 overall and 4-8 in Big South play, Winthrop heads to Charlotte, N.C. tomorrow to face the 49ers of UNC Charlotte in their first of two matchups this season. First pitch will be at 6 p.m.
Winthrop and Charlotte will meet for the 43rd time with the 49ers leading the series, 18-23-1, including 12-7 in the Queen City. The Eagles lost the last meeting, 8-0 on the road on Apr. 12, 2022. A few days before that saw Winthrop win 9-6 on Apr. 6 at home, thus resulting a season split between the two schools. Winthrop has lost seven of the past 11 meetings and is seeking their first win in Charlotte since a 3-2 margin on Apr. 4, 2017. The teams first met on Apr. 17, 1980 with the Eagles winning 3-0 in Rock Hill.
The 49ers came off a week in which they were shutout Big South member Radford at home 10-0 in seven innings and then splitting a Thursday doubleheader with nationally-ranked #24 UTSA at home before the third game on Saturday was canceled. Charlotte has won six season series on the year so far and are currently 15-15 overall and 6-5 in Conference USA competition. Their biggest win of the year was a shocking 6-2 win on the neutral turf of Truist Field in downtown Charlotte against a then-Top 5 South Carolina team on Mar. 21, snapping what was then an 11-game win streak by the Gamecocks and handed USC what was at the time their second loss.
Charlotte was picked to finish fourth in C-USA after going 36-22 (17-13 C-USA) in 2022.
Winthrop enters 2023 predicted to finish ninth in the Big South Conference. The Eagles finished the 2022 season with an 18-34 (11-13 Big South) record. The Eagles also welcome back 18 players, nine of them starters and 16 newcomers, all either freshman or transfers.
